Abstract
A photoresist composition comprises about 0.5 to about 20 parts by weight of a photo-acid generator, about 10 to about 70 parts by weight of a novolac resin containing a hydroxyl group, about 1 to about 40 parts by weight of a cross-linker that comprises an alkoxymethylmelamine compound, and about 10 to about 150 parts by weight of a solvent.
